Must-Orders: The Muffuletta and a Pimm’s Cup

Locals and visitors take the time to swing in to the Napoleon House one or more times throughout their time in the town, and smart folks already know the things they’re ordering: a muffuletta and a Pimm’s Cup.

Let us start out with additionally essential in New Orleans, an urban area where individuals just take their particular cocktails extremely severely. The Pimm’s Cup was combined by Napoleon home club from inside the belated 1940s and is also produced just with Pimm’s No. 1, a gin-based liqueur, lemonade, 7 Up, and ice, garnished with a slice of cucumber. It is the best refreshment, especially through the sweltering heating of brand new Orleans’ summer season.

A muffuletta is significant adequate to help you stay heading throughout afternoon, or maybe later in the day before per night out and about. Next into town’s hearty po-boy sandwiches, the muffuletta is actually their quintessential sub fashioned with treated meats and cheese, slathered in olive green salad spread on sesame-crusted Italian loaves of bread.

The sandwich is so common here the chefs make 50 gallons of these olive green salad distribute every week — and so they only use several tablespoons for every single sandwich.

Classic atmosphere for Special Occasions

The Napoleon home gives the right environment to draw everybody else from regional entrepreneurs to vacationers, lovers, and households. The cafe had gotten their title when owner Nicholas offered it to Napoleon as a spot of sanctuary when he ended up being exiled from France in 1821, but the effective and legendary statesman passed away prior to getting the chance to get him upon the deal.

Ghost Tales produce Fun Date Conversation

Everyone knows brand new Orleans provides a colorful past — however think areas of that last are nevertheless about in the form of roaming spirits. Ghost trips are common in French one-fourth, and groups always make a stop in the Napoleon residence.

Many people have reported watching a tiny bit outdated lady capturing about premises, while paranormal experts have come with screening equipment and identified two some other spirits nicely.

Purportedly, absolutely a lady who haunts the grounds and a vintage sailor who’s having rum on bar. Interestingly, in the 1800s, the upstairs attic was used as a barracks for sailors.

An essential end for just about any unique Orleans Visit

The Napoleon House, using its history, muffulettas, and Pimm’s Cups, helps make the short list of this couple of locations regarded as a must-see during brand new Orleans. The 200-year-old building is actually, basically, a landmark watering gap.

It absolutely was previously owned by Impastato family, whom got it in 1914 before attempting to sell it to Ralph Brennan over a century later in 2015. The new owners went out of their strategy to maintain restaurant authentic and initial, both in the fresh, delicious ingredients and tasteful atmosphere.
